Scalloped Cabbage

Scalloped Cabbage
Scalloped Cabbage requires approximately 45 minutes from start to finish. This recipe makes 8 servings with 149 calories, 3g of protein, and 10g of fat each. Instructions

1
Cook shredded cabbage, covered, in a small amount of boiling salted water for 15 minutes or until cabbage is tender; drain well. Set cooked cabbage aside, and keep warm.

2
Melt 3 tablespoons butter in a heavy saucepan over low heat; add flour, stirring until smooth. Cook mixture 1 minute, stirring constantly. Gradually stir in milk. Cook sauce over medium heat, stirring constantly, until thickened and bubbly. Stir in pepper.

3
Place one-third cracker crumbs in a lightly greased shallow 2 1/2-quart baking dish. Spoon half of cabbage over cracker crumbs.

4
Pour half of sauce mixture over cabbage. Repeat layers, ending with cracker crumbs. Dot cracker crumb layers with 2 tablespoons butter. Cover and bake at 350 for 30 minutes.

5
Serve warm in baking dish.
